Real Estate Litigation

asbestos lawsuits, a mineral that is fibrous, has many industrial uses. It was used for decades in construction materials and structures because it is pliable as well as fire-resistant and has high tensile strengths. Unfortunately, asbestos is toxic and can cause a variety of mesothelioma related illnesses, such as lung cancer and pleural mesothelioma. These are usually fatal. Asbestos victims need legal representation to seek compensation for funeral expenses, medical bills loss of income, and other losses.

The most experienced mesothelioma lawyers have expertise in asbestos litigation and can assist their clients in understanding their rights. The type of lawyer that works on a basis of contingent fees. This means that the fees paid to the attorney are contingent upon an acceptable settlement or verdict for their client. Lawyers may charge for research, writing legal documents, conducting and defending depositions, preparing for trial and conducting them, and other tasks related to cases.

It's important to hire an experienced attorney as quickly as you can after mesothelioma diagnosis, or the death of a loved one who died from an asbestos-related illness. The statute of limitations allows an period of time to file a lawsuit, and typically, that time limit begins at the time of diagnosis for personal injury cases, and the date of death in claims for wrongful deaths.

A national firm that specializes in asbestos litigation often has access to key information and databases and can help patients in determining when, where, and how they were exposed to asbestos. This information is vital in seeking compensation from asbestos producers responsible for victims' health problems.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will also inform victims about asbestos trust funds where they may be eligible for financial compensation. A number of asbestos companies have filed for bankruptcy, and though the majority of these firms can't be sued, their assets can be used for victims to receive compensation. This is how asbestos victims and their families are able to get millions of dollars in settlements and verdicts. Workers Compensation Claims

Those who have been di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ness such as mesothelioma or lung cancer could be eligible for financial compensation. Compensation from a lawsuit could be used to pay medical bills, lost wages funeral and burial costs in the case the death of a victim, and many more. Attorneys who specialize in asbestos litigation are able to assist families of victims pursue claims against those responsible for the exposure.

Weitz & Luxenberg's attorneys are experts in asbestos-related personal injury and workers compensation cases. Their clients include railroad workers, shipyard workers, those working in the automotive and construction industries, as well as veterans of the United States Armed Forces. They were exposed to asbestos in the workplace and then brought it home with them. The asbestos exposure impacted their families.

Attorneys can help victims with filing claims for disability benefits at the Occupational Safety and Health Administration. Workers' compensation can provide compensation to those suffering from mesothelioma, or any other asbestos-related illnesses that are linked to their work. To qualify for this assistance the person suffering from the condition must demonstrate that he or she was exposed to asbestos lawsuit working and that exposure to asbestos caused the disease.

People who have been diagnosed with an asbestos-related condition should seek legal advice as soon as they can. Mesothelioma is a potentially fatal cancer, but it is difficult to identify. It is often diagnosed many years after exposure. A skilled attorney can help the victim and his or her family gather evidence, like medical records and employment history in order to establish a successful claim for compensation.

The statute of limitations for most personal injury cases is three years, but this is typically extended in mesothelioma cases and other asbestos-related illness claims. Mesothelioma symptoms can develop over a long period of time and those affected could have worked or lived in a variety of locations across the globe. It is essential that anyone who believes that they could be entitled to compensation promptly contact an attorney to review their claim.

Personal Injury Claims

Asbestos exposure can cause a variety of serious diseases. These include mesothelioma (a cancerous tumor that targets the lung's lining or stomach). It can also cause asbestosis, a painful and disfiguring respiratory condition. Individuals suffering from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ases have a legal right pursue compensation for past, present and future medical expenses as well as lost income, pain and suffering, and punitive damages in certain states.

A New York asbestos lawyer can help victims and their family members receive the compensation they deserve for these devastating ailments. A law firm that handles these cases on a national basis could be able to obtain better compensation than any single state law firm due to its resources and connections.

Lawyers at the Lanier Law Firm specialize in holding large corporations accountable when they knowingly expose people to asbestos. As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ral was sought-after for its properties to ward off flames in the 20th Century. It was used in everything from shipbuilding to automobile brakes. The Lanier Law Firm has helped individuals suffering from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ases receive compensation for their losses.

Many people in the United States have been exposed to asbestos in their jobs. The most vulnerable to exposure are those who worked on ships, in the construction industry, in powerhouses, and in the automotive industry. Additionally, some military veterans may have been exposed asbestos during their service in the Navy or the Army. An experienced lawyer can help veterans get VA benefits for disability and free medical care.
